Description

Vegetarian/ Vegan cafe serving takeaway food and coffee, and take home meals, using fresh local food, including from Community Gardens, and Garden Schools. We are now getting locals to grow Native Foods, like Warrigal Greens, for the cafe. We support Education for Sustainability (EfS), and work with local schools, and UniSA PCP (Placement) Students, and with other Community groups, including NW Schools & Community Network, and the Semaphore Composting Network. Over an 8 year trial period, we diverted over 50,000 kg of scraps, etc from landfill. Since opening our first cafe, Sarah's, in 1978, we've served over 1 million customers, promoting sustainability by example, from our cafe's passive sustainable design, to kitchen management (nearly zero wastage), and local food ( less Food Miles). We've minimised the Cafe's Footprint by over 50 %. At the moment, we're ensuring that vegos and vegans have great food available. With orders, a bottle of vegan wine can be purchased (cond apply).
